Why are hypotheses so important to controlled experiments? The hypothesis sets the stage for the experiment because the entire experiment is based on your hypothesis. The hypothesis is your educated guess what will result from the experiment.

What role do hypotheses play in scientific inquiry?

What role do hypotheses play in scientific inquiry? A hypothesis provides a testable explanation from an observation. Scientific questions are developed from initial observations. Observations are also made to test hypotheses.

Can hypothesis be proven?

Upon analysis of the results, a hypothesis can be rejected or modified, but it can never be proven to be correct 100 percent of the time. For example, relativity has been tested many times, so it is generally accepted as true, but there could be an instance, which has not been encountered, where it is not true.

What three things make a good hypothesis?

However, there are some important things to consider when building a compelling hypothesis.

  • State the problem that you are trying to solve. Make sure that the hypothesis clearly defines the topic and the focus of the experiment.
  • Try to write the hypothesis as an if-then statement.
  • Define the variables.

How do you explain the scientific method to a child?

WHAT IS THE SCIENTIFIC METHOD FOR KIDS? The scientific method is a process or method of research. A problem is identified, information about the problem is gathered, a hypothesis or question is formulated from the information, and the hypothesis is put to test with an experimented to prove or disprove it’s validity.
